Meteors are just bits of dust, dirt or debris in space that enter Earth's atmosphere. They are often from comets. As they enter our atmosphere they burn up and fly through it. They look like stars shooting through the sky, hence the common names shooting stars or falling stars.
Meteors are mistakenly called shooting stars because they appear as streaks of light in the sky when they enter Earth's atmosphere and burn up. They are not actually stars, but small rocky or metallic objects, often debris from comets or asteroids, that collide with Earth's atmosphere. As they heat up from the friction, they vaporize and create the glowing trails we see.

First off, shooting stars aren`t actually stars. They`re actually pieces of space rock called meteors. When meteors enter Earth`s atmosphere, they burn up, producing bright lights as they move through the sky. That is, if it`s night. If it`s day, then you can`t see them light up. Meteors are so fast that people say they`re faster than a speeding bullet, hence the name ''shooting'' star.
